Tears
No thief in the night stole her from me,
It was a mighty tempest, like you would witness at sea.
For a time she was safe, far from harm’s way,
Until her trust a friend did betray.
Looking back on all I have done,
A different life path may have saved my loved one.
But a life of power and greed I did follow,
Now my loved one is gone, and my soul it is hollow.
I have missed her terribly all through the years,
Now all I have left is her memory in tears.
